Course Details

Fundamentals of Precision Farming: An introduction to the principles and practices of precision farming, including the use of technology to improve crop yields and reduce environmental impact.
Precision Farming Technologies: A survey of the latest tools and techniques used in precision farming, including GPS guidance systems, remote sensing, and variable rate technology.
Data Analysis in Precision Farming: An exploration of the methods and tools used to analyze the large amounts of data generated by precision farming systems, including machine learning and data visualization.
Soil Management in Precision Farming: An examination of the role of soil management in precision farming, including the use of soil sampling and variable rate fertilization.
Crop Health Monitoring: An overview of the techniques used to monitor crop health in precision farming, including remote sensing and drone technology.
Water Management in Precision Farming: A discussion of the strategies and tools used to optimize water use in precision farming, including irrigation management and precision drainage.
Precision Farming and Food Safety: An exploration of the relationship between precision farming and food safety, including the use of technology to improve traceability and reduce contamination.
Regulations and Compliance in Precision Farming: An overview of the legal and regulatory framework governing precision farming, including compliance with food safety and environmental regulations.
Business and Economic Considerations in Precision Farming: A review of the economic and business aspects of precision farming, including cost-benefit analysis and market trends.
